Centrioles Definition:

  • Animals and many unicellular organisms have hollow and cylindrical organelles known as centrioles.

Centrioles Notes:

Centrioled are found near the nucleus of an animal cells along with a couple of small cylindrical organelles, preoccupied the enforcement of spindle fibers in cell division: identical in internal structure to a basal body. However, centrioles are not found in conifer (pinophyta) fungi and flowering plants. They are formed by nine sets of short microtubule that are arranged in cylindrical form.
